Hello Families, You are invited to attend the Northeast Iowa Family STEM Festival on Thursday, April 28 from 4:00 p.m. to 7:00 p.m. at Regents Center at Luther College in Decorah. The festival is free and open to students and their families. The goals of the festival are to promote, inspire and engage youth in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ics (STEM) activities and to introduce children and parents to STEM careers in their local communities. The Iowa Students for Tobacco Education and Prevention (ISTEP) group presented the dangers of tobacco use to the PreK-6th grades at St. Joes. The ISTEP group of 13 picked a grade and worked hard at finding age appropriate material to get their message about the dangers of tobacco use across to those students. The ISTEP students did a fantastic job of presenting this information to the lower grades in a fun and informative manner. Mrs. Heying's 4th grade class and the Lent committee wanted to raise money for the new Inclusive playground that will be at Runion Park. They decided to host a movie after school. From this fundraiser along with some money from the parish, we were able to present a check to Maggie and Jenny who are Inclusive Park committee members for $674.72.

In Computer Science today the 3rd graders learned about conditionals through a card game and ended up creating their own. The 7th and 8th grade students continued working on creating HTML code for a website centered on something that is important to them or they personally enjoy.
